The Guardian's Echo: The Last Flight of the Sky Dragon
In the heart of the ancient world of Aeloria, where the sky was a tapestry woven with the colors of a thousand suns, there lived a guardian named Erevan. His feathers, a blend of the deepest blues and purples, glowed with an inner light that could guide the lost and comfort the weary. Erevan was the last of his kind, tasked with the preservation of the sky and its delicate balance with the world below.
Beside him, soaring with grace and power, was the Sky Dragon, a creature of legend and myth, known only in the whispers of old. The Sky Dragon was not just a guardian but also a protector, her scales shimmering with an ethereal glow that could shield the world from the darkest of forces.
Together, they patrolled the sky, their eyes ever-watchful, their hearts ever-true. They had faced many trials, from the cunning of the sky pirates to the wrath of the storm gods, but nothing had prepared them for the betrayal that was to come.
The betrayal was subtle at first, a whisper in the wind that grew into a tempest. Erevan’s closest ally, a fellow guardian named Liria, was revealed to be a traitor, working with the dark sorcerer, Malakar, who sought to unravel the very fabric of the sky itself. Liria’s betrayal was not just a personal wound but a wound to the very heart of Aeloria.
In the days that followed, Erevan and the Sky Dragon were forced to confront the truth: the sky was being corrupted, its colors dimming, its balance teetering on the edge of collapse. The sanctuary, a floating island known as the Aetherium, was in peril, and with it, the world below.
The guardian and the dragon flew to the Aetherium, their path fraught with danger. The skies were now filled with dark clouds, and the air was thick with the scent of corruption. They found Liria, her eyes hollow with the weight of her sin, and Malakar, his dark sorcery casting a shadow over the island.
"Your time is up, Erevan," Malakar sneered. "The sky belongs to me now."
Erevan and the Sky Dragon fought valiantly, their battle echoing through the heavens. The guardian's feathers, once a beacon of hope, now rained down upon the battlefield, a testament to the struggle they faced. The Sky Dragon, with her scales glowing brighter than ever, unleashed a roar that shook the very foundations of the sky.
But it was not enough. Malakar's power was too great, and the balance of the sky was unraveling. Erevan knew that they had to make a sacrifice. "Fly, Sky Dragon," he called out. "Fly to the heart of the sky and release the last of your power. The world needs it."
With a final, desperate effort, the Sky Dragon soared higher and higher, her form growing smaller and smaller until she was just a pinpoint of light against the endless blue. Erevan watched her go, his heart heavy with sorrow but his resolve unwavering.
The Sky Dragon's sacrifice was not in vain. Her light ignited a reaction in the sky, a reaction that pushed back the darkness and restored the balance. The colors of the sky began to return, the clouds to part, and the world below to breathe once more.
But the guardian felt the weight of the loss. The Sky Dragon was gone, her spirit forever entwined with the fabric of the sky. Erevan knew that he had to continue his mission, but he also knew that the world would never be the same.
As the last guardian of the sky, Erevan would have to face the darkness that still lingered, the corruption that still threatened to consume the world. But he would do so with the memory of the Sky Dragon and the knowledge that sometimes, the greatest sacrifice is the one we make for the ones we love.
